Transaction f58b80e8c1e46acf70c70d2c2d2b44ed6533cc214f6cfe77b033bfb932bc7e9c

4 Input
1 Outputs
  • f58b80e8c1e46acf70c70d2c2d2b44ed6533cc214f6cfe77b033bfb932bc7e9c:0
  • value  150224816
    address  3863bq8H2RLd4bzQ69m2wHwXvSFQJNB1bT